Bent photos... well, its one of those things like, once you know what youre doing, you can break the rules, but stick with straight photos for now. It will make you a better photographer. In cookies, the background is slanted, but the cookies are not, and it really doesnt bother me. The depth of field is good there. Powerlines: Something needs to be parallel to the frame. Especially with the style of some of these, that aligning with the frame will make much cleaner photos. Bench = Bad Lighting. Your subject is in the shadow, and not exposed correctly. Its ok to take pictures of things in shadow, but make sure you get them exposed right. And make sure that the overexposed sunlit areas are not distracting.
I think my favorite is trolley seats. SpiralStairWell is kinda overdone, ya know. Theres so much to take pictures of. People always make good photographs, and most photographers are too embarrassed to take pictures of people (myself included), but keep in mind, theyre interesting. Even from behind, when they arent looking.
I might be able to tell you more if I saw bigger pictures. What camera are you using?
